What are the primary types of private school options available to families in Rockford, Illinois?
Rockford offers a diverse range of private school models to fit different family values and educational goals. The most prominent types include independent college-preparatory schools like Keith Country Day School, which follows a secular, rigorous academic model. There are also comprehensive Christian schools, such as the Rockford Christian Schools system, which provides education from preschool through high school with a faith-based curriculum. Additionally, families can find smaller parochial academies like North Boone Christian Academy, often with a strong community focus. Rockford also has several Catholic schools under the Diocese of Rockford and other religious-affiliated institutions, providing a variety of philosophical approaches to private education.
How does tuition for Rockford, IL private schools compare to the state average, and what financial aid options are locally available?
Tuition for Rockford-area private schools generally ranges from approximately $6,000 to $15,000+ per year for K-12, which is often below the average for Chicago-area suburbs but aligned with or slightly above the state average for similar cities. A critical financial consideration specific to Illinois is the Invest in Kids Act Tax Credit Scholarship Program. This state program provides scholarships for eligible families, and many Rockford private schools, including Rockford Christian and others, participate. Additionally, most schools offer their own need-based financial aid, and some have parish or congregational support for member families. It's essential to inquire directly with each school about their specific tuition rates and all available aid avenues.

What is the typical enrollment timeline and process for private schools in Rockford, IL?
The enrollment process in Rockford typically begins in the fall, with open houses held from September through January for the following academic year. Key deadlines for application submissions often fall between January and March. Many schools, like Keith Country Day, require an entrance assessment, a student interview, and submission of previous records. Rolling admissions may continue if spaces are available. A crucial local factor is that some popular schools, particularly those with smaller class sizes, have waiting pools for certain grades, so early inquiry is recommended. It's also common for schools to host shadow days for prospective students to experience a typical day firsthand.
For families considering both sectors, what are some notable differences between the Rockford Public School District (RPS 205) and the private school landscape?
The most significant differences lie in scale, curriculum, and choice. RPS 205 is a large, diverse public district offering specialized magnet programs (e.g., gifted, International Baccalaureate at Auburn High School) but with assigned schools based on geography. Rockford private schools offer smaller average class sizes, distinct mission-driven education (e.g., secular college-prep or faith-based), and often more uniform disciplinary and curricular approaches across the entire school. Financially, public schools are tax-funded, while private schools require tuition. In terms of performance, both sectors have high-achieving students, but private schools often publish higher aggregate standardized test scores and college acceptance lists. The choice often comes down to a family's priority on specific values, community size, and educational philosophy.
